China Ming Yang Lands 1.1GW of New Bids in January, Guangdong Government Releases Policy to Support Company Growth

ZHONGSHAN, China, Feb. 1, 2011 /PRNewswire-Asia/ -- China Ming Yang Wind Power (NYSE: MY) ("Ming Yang" or the "Company"), announced that it has won a total of 1.1GW new bids in January 2011, including 200MW for its 2.5/3.0MW Super Compact Drive ("SCD") wind turbine generators in both onshore and offshore tenders.

Ming Yang reports that it won bids in all tenders in which it participated, with the aggregate winning bids in excess of 20% of the amounts available for tender. Over 75% of the new bids won were from the top 5 national wind farm operators, including Huandian Power International, Huaneng Power International, Datang International Power Generation, Datang New Energy and China Longyuan Power, further improving its customer mix among national and provincial operators.

About China Ming Yang Wind Power Group Limited

China Ming Yang Wind Power Group Limited (NYSE: MY) is a leading and fast-growing wind turbine manufacturer in China, focusing on designing, manufacturing, selling and servicing megawatt-class wind turbines.  Ming Yang produces advanced, highly adaptable wind turbines with high energy output and low energy production costs and provides customers with comprehensive post-sales services.  Ming Yang cooperates with aerodyn Energiesysteme, one of the world's leading wind turbine design firms based in Germany, to develop wind turbines and share intellectual property rights. Ming Yang's key customers include the five largest state-owned power producers in China, with an aggregate installed capacity accounting for more than 50% of China's newly installed capacity in 2009.
